Another way to make your garden attractive is through applying landscape lighting design. This allows you to give emphasis and highlights on the striking parts of your garden. Also, you will be able to freely change those overlooked parts in your garden. Today, many homeowners do use lamps, lanterns, spotlights and the likes to give their garden the best lighting effect which in fact really give more beauty and uniqueness to your garden.

However, when choosing the lighting materials you want to use in your garden you also need to have a planned budget for it. Remember, not all lightings are of the same price; they vary depending on the quality. In addition, when using lighting design, you can utilize magazines as reference just always keep in mind to choose the best lighting that can enhance the look of your garden more. Just do some initial checking first for you to know which part of your garden need emphasis and lighting.
